Katerina Tannenbaum As Lisette In And Just Like That

Katerina Tannenbaum was born in Portland, Oregon, on June 28, 1993. At the age of 4, Katerina participated in acting and dancing courses. Her mother identified her skill for acting, so she motivated her to sign up for the courses. After finishing her senior high school education and learning, she joined Stella Adler Conservatory in New York City.

Career And Movies
Tannenbaum began her acting career with several jobs before acting. In 2015, she made her debut in the short film “Aura.” Three years later, Katerina reappeared in the short film “Poor Cherry.”
In 2018, Katerina acted in the TV series “The Bold Type,” where she played the character Lelia. The following year, Katerina obtained a famous role in the TV series “Sweet plus Bitter,” where she represented more than a year with the role of Becky.
In 2019, Katerina debuted in Entangled and toenailed her character, Francesca. In 2020, Katerina obtained an incredible deal from the Netflix series “AJ and the Queen,” in which she starred the protagonist Brianna Douglas. Katerina also got one more opportunity by playing the popular role of “Ash” in the Betty series. She has lately shown up in the movie “40 LOVE.” In recent times, Katerina once more took the audience by storm with the role of Lisette in “And Just Like That.’
